《汇编语言程序设计》
教学大纲
山西信息职业技术学院
2008年4月
目录
一、课程的性质、目标和任务:_____________ - 1 -
二、先修课程_____________ - 1 -
三、课程教学内容、教学形式和教学要求_____________ - 1 -
1、理论教学大纲内容:_____________ - 1 -
2、实验教学大纲内容:_____________ - 3 -
3、课程教学要求:_____________ - 3 -
4、教学形式:_____________ - 3 -
5、作业:_____________ - 3 -
四、学时分配:_____________ - 4 -
五、考核形式:_____________ - 4 -
六、教材及参考书_____________ - 4 -
《汇编语言》教学大纲
一、课程的性质、目标和任务:
汇编语言是高等院校计算机软、硬件及应用专业的专业基础(核心)课,它不仅是计算机原理、接口技术及操作系统等其它核心课程的先行课,而且对训练学生掌握程序设计技术、加深对计算机工作原理的理解有非常重要的作用。通过本课程的学习,使学习者掌握8086至Pentiun微处理器的寻址方式、指令系统及其汇编语言程序设计基本思想和方法,同时通过汇编语言程序设计进一步掌握利用程序设计充分发挥计算机效率的基本思想。通过上机实践熟悉上机操作和程序调试技术。
二、先修课程
《高级程序设计语言》、《数字逻辑》
三、课程教学内容、教学形式和教学要求
1、理论教学大纲内容:
第一章 80X86微型计算机组织
1.微处理器的发展(要求达到”了解”层次)
2.IBM-PC系列计算机的存储器和I/O系统(要求达到”认识”层次)
3.微处理器的工作模式及实模式下的存储器寻址方法(要求达到”理解”层次)
4. 微处理器的工作模式及保护模式下的存储器寻址方法(要求达到”了解”层次)
第二章__ 寻址方式与汇编语言程序的组织
1. 汇编语言概论(要求达到”了解”层次)
2. 数据存储器、程序存储器以及堆栈存储器的寻址方式(要求达到”理解”层次)
3. 汇编语言程序的组成(要求达到”认识”层次)
4. 段的简化定义(要求达到”认识”层次)